The Democratic Republic of the Congo (DRC) is responding to its 17th Ebola Virus Disease (EVD) outbreak, confirmed in May 2026 and affecting Ituri, North Kivu, and South Kivu provinces. The situation remains complex and evolving, with transmission occurring in both community and health-care settings. Response efforts are led by national authorities in a context shaped by health system limitations, logistical constraints, insecurity, displacement, and diverse community perceptions influencing health-seeking behaviors.
UNICEF supports the Government through a multi-sectoral approach, focusing on community engagement, surveillance, infection prevention, and the continuity of essential services for vulnerable populations.
This context requires strong coordination, adaptability, and cultural sensitivity to support effective and equitable response efforts, particularly for children and at-risk communities.
**How can you make a difference?**
Strengthen the operational implementation of community-based surveillance to improve the early detection, reporting, and follow-up of suspected Ebola cases at the community level.

**To qualify as an advocate for every child you will have…**
**Minimum requirements**
- **Education**: An advanced university degree (Master’s degree or equivalent) in Public Health, Medicine, or a related field is required.
- **Work Experience:** A minimum of five (5) years of relevant professional experience in community surveillance and/or public health programmes is required.
- **Skills:** Teamwork and Collaboration, Effective Community Communication, Organization and Attention to Detail, Results Orientation, Ability to Work in Challenging and Emergency Contexts
- Strong Knowledge of Epidemiological Surveillance, Proficiency in Community-Based Surveillance (CBS) Approaches, Understanding of Community Contexts and Local Dynamics, Ability to Engage and Work Effectively with Community Stakeholders, Supervision, Coaching, and Training Skills
- **Language Requirements:** Fluency in French is required. Intermediate proficiency in English is an asset.
**Desirables**
- Language: Knowledge of another official UN language (Arabic, Chinese, French, Russian or Spanish) or a local language
- Ebola, cholera, disease outbreaks
- Relevant experience at country level, particularly in development, fragile settings and humanitarian contexts.
- Experience in epidemic response (e.g., Ebola, cholera, or other disease outbreaks) is considered an asset.
